We have received a few reports lately about Russian people from different parts of Russia building many feet tall pyramid like structures. We don’t know exact reasons for the to do this, but some of them say they believe in unknown powers that can be drawn down to the Earth with the help of pyramids, giving supernatural powers to the owners of the pyramids like the ideal health or even immortality, at least this is what they say themselves. Here we have photos and videos from the three of different pyramid sights in modern Russia. All the structures are around hundred feet tall!

Perhaps not only superstitious, but in general more spiritual then most other nationalities. Even at the time of total state-enforced atheism Russians needed a God. That place was of course taken by Lenin. His image was on the wall of every good soviet citizen. Students, before attempting an exam or submitting their dissertations, stood in front of his image and asked him for help. In a moment of sorrow, people used to take his image, place it near then, and speak to it as if it was a real person.
Then came the perestroika and religious freedom. And what happened? Instead of visiting the Mausoleum and attending demostartions people started visiting the Church and attending the Liturgy. Icons replaced the images of Lenin and the Bible replaced the Communist Manifesto.
